Responsibilities

Drive the cross-functional strategy, execution, and impact for Commerce teams in partnership with Product, Design, and Data leadership
Work across the company to drive understanding and adoption of platform capabilities and patterns in a systematic, measurable way across Gusto
Build a culture of enthusiasm for our platform work that leads to greater productivity and higher quality and cohesion of the experiences we ship to customers
Empower a team of senior engineers - operating in an architect capacity as well as engineering people empowerers (managers) - creating alignment, clarity, and high morale; drive quick but informed decision making and helping them get unblocked
As a key stakeholder, contribute to the broader Gusto communication of vision, strategy, and stakeholder alignment via monthly and quarterly reviews
Hold a high standard for our User Experience by thinking across our stack (data models and architectural decisions that also impact UI) and are a voice for front-end excellence
Getting in the weeds with senior IC leaders across engineering, design, data, and product to discuss trade-offs, define the green path, and help advance great decisions

Required

Demonstrated experience scaling platform products, including proven strategies to drive internal adoption of new methods, patterns, and capabilities
Strong technical acumen with the ability to understand and debate tradeoffs and approaches in building scalable architecture and data models
Sharp skills as a builder — even as you’ve become a strategic leader, you are fundamentally a builder who can jump into problem-solving with team members when they need support
High standard, systems-first approach, and strong point of view for the user experience informed by customer empathy, research, data, and customer support insights
Led highly distributed engineering teams and managers for a minimum of 5 years, with hands-on development experience for a minimum of 10 years
Strong product opinions, including the ability to tell a product story that is clear and inspiring; work with teams to map dependencies, risks, and tradeoffs to increase velocity and make the vision real
The ability to inspire and motivate a cross-functional team, including PMs, designers, engineers, data scientists, and other partners
Tenacity, directness, and the ability to build relationships across the organization - including with app leads and execs - designed to increase understanding of what we’re doing and why, and to drive the velocity of adoption of our platform capabilities
10+ years working on high-growth digital experiences, with at least four years focused on platform features
Demonstrated experience scaling platform products end-to-end (architecture to UI) at a company with a modern tech stack
Technical leader who can bridge technology and business and can speak to the impact they’ve had in specific, tangible, and non-jargon-y terms
Great collaborator who knows how to work effectively with cross-functional partners and drive alignment
Has likely held senior leadership titles with a focus on platform products; product-minded leaders in other crafts who fit the profile are also welcome to apply
Excellent technical acumen with the ability to architect, design, and discuss tradeoffs
Strong opinions and high standards around the user experience — is particularly adept at thinking about systems, cohesiveness, and how to approach governance
Has managed senior people in the past and knows how to align them, when to give space, and when/how to coach and motivate

Preferred

Ideal candidates will have seen a platform through a period of growth, transition, or change and will have proven methodologies and tangible examples of how they’ve driven adoption
